the nba is about marketing and what sells, and to a MUCH lesser extent, winning. wade/shaq and lebron are 'stars', so the nba likes to put a combination of teams that sell..either by winning and/or star power. why else would solid teams like toronto, new orleans, etc get so little to no national tv coverage while garbage teams like miami or boring teams like the cavs get on nat'l tv all the time?
